- AR Rafiq is an entrepreneur, Technologists, connector, and social change agent who runs Inspurate LLC a web/mobile design and development boutique based out of Silicon Valley and Karachi.
AR is passionate about the evolution of the Internet, Renewable Energy, Social Entrepreneurship, and building globally networked grassroots Entrepreneurial communities.
He is also the founder and chief coordinator at SA Relief a 501(c)(3) California registered not-for-profit providing disaster management and relief to marginalized communties in South Asia. Posts
